This caramelized pork ribs recipe is incredibly versatile, allowing you to tailor it to your taste.
For a spicier kick, add chili flakes or sriracha to the marinade. If you prefer a tangy twist, a splash of rice vinegar or lime juice can enhance the flavor profile.
For added depth, substitute honey with brown sugar or maple syrup. Cooking tips:
ensure the ribs are well-marinated for maximum flavor, and sear them evenly for a beautiful caramelized crust.
Pairing the dish with steamed rice or a fresh side salad creates a balanced and satisfying meal.
To store caramelized pork ribs, let them cool completely before placing them in an airtight container. Refrigerate for up to 3–4 days.
For longer storage, transfer the ribs to a freezer-safe container or bag, removing as much air as possible, and freeze for up to 2 months.
When reheating, warm them gently on the stove or in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until heated through, adding a splash of water or broth to maintain their juicy texture.
